[CBS 8:00] The Dukes Of Hazzard [Reg]: New Deputy In Town
Season 4, episode 20
W: Si Rose   D: Denver Pyle

With Peggy Rea (Lulu Hogg), Gary Graham (Denny Logan), Tracy Scoggins (Linda Mae Barnes), Terence Knox (Rafe Logan), Rayford Barnes (Marshall).
When an efficient -- and awesomely beautiful -- patrol officer effortlessly arrests Bo and Luke on traffic charges, an impressed Boss Hogg and Roscoe immediately hire her as a new deputy.

[ABC 8:00] Benson [Reg]: Street Gangs
Season 3, episode 13
W: David Langston Smyrl   D: John Rich

With Jesse D. Goins (Calvin), Kevin Guillaume (Mr. Klein), Larry B. Scott (Little John), Sal Lopez (Spider), Louis Rivera (Pac Man).
Benson tries to help a street gang stay out of trouble by suggesting the members bid for a job in the city which requires a government contract.

[CBS 9:00] Dallas [Reg]: Adoption
Season 5, episode 19
W: Howard Lakin   D: Larry Hagman

With Priscilla Pointer (Rebecca Wentworth), Art Hindle (Jeff Farraday), Lindsay Bloom (Bonnie Robertson), Dennis Redfield (Roger Larson), Fern Fitzgerald (Marilee Stone), Ray Wise (Blair Sullivan), Anne Lucas (Cassie), Ron Tomme (Charles Eccles), Robert Alan Browne (Breslin), Don Starr (Jordon Lee), Herb Vigran (Judge Thornby).
J.R. has Ray arrested during one of his binges then shows up at jail and persuades a distraught Ray to sign over his ten voting shares in Ewing Oil; Cliff discovers J.R.'s plot to get him a phony job with Olco Industries.

[CBS 10:00] Falcon Crest [Reg]: Family Reunion
Season 1, episode 12
W: Robert L. McCullough   D: Larry Elikann

With Lana Turner (Jacqueline Perrault), Margaret Ladd (Emma Channing), Mel Ferrer (Philip Erikson), Suzie McCullough (Flower Store Clerk), Peter Ashton (Caterer).
Chase's wealthy mother returns to Falcon Crest, rekindling fear and hatred between Angela and her former sister-in-law, who has come to warn Chase of Angela's treacherous nature.
